Bring the kids to Smugglers’ Notch Resort, a special destination designed to provide perfect family vacation experiences on the snowy slopes. Cozy condominium-style accommodations complement an abundance of activities. The resort village is a true family community.

Patient and skilled instructors help beginners fall in love with the snow at the Snow Sport University ski and snowboard school, which holds classes for anyone from the age of 2.5 years. Find excellent childcare facilities as well, allowing parents time to hone their own skills on the slopes. In a variety of programs for groups with children ranging from 6 weeks to 17 years of age, kids can make friends in a fun and educational environment.

At one time smugglers really did use this “notch” or mountain pass, earning the area its name. At the center of Smugglers’ Notch action, find the Madonna, Morse and Sterling mountains. Smugglers’ Notch has an annual snowfall of over 300 inches (7.5 meters). Three mountains provide ski runs for all abilities. Explore 1,000 acres (405 hectares) of terrain, extensive Nordic routes and 78 trails for alpine skiing, including 25 perfect for experts.

Smugglers’ Notch Resort has activities for all seasons. Play at the indoor FunZone Family Entertainment & Recreation Center which features rides, obstacle courses and minigolf. In summer warm up with hiking, zip lining, mountain biking, canoeing and kayaking, climbing, Segway touring, fly fishing and trekking with furry llamas. Eight pools and four waterslides provide refreshment on a summer day, with views of the green mountains. The Bootleggers’ Basin provides a natural option, with clear waters fringed by lush lawns and reeds.

Choose food from around the world at a dozen different restaurants at Smugglers’ Notch Resort. Sample local vodka, rum, gin and bourbon at Smugglers’ Notch Distillery. Travel between venues and amenities with the on-demand Resort Shuttle. Check online for road closures during winter, as well as driving directions from major centers in Canada and the U.S. The closest town to Smugglers’ Notch is Jeffersonville.

Shopping

In Smugglers Notch, you can shop at Straw Corner Shops for unique gifts. If you're up for a drive, visit Essex Outlets for a variety of shops and entertainment, or check out Cold Hollow Cider Mill for delightful local products, both located 15 miles away.

Recreation

Explore the Brewster Ridge Disc Golf Course for a fun outdoor experience amidst nature. For relaxation, stroll along the Stowe Recreation Path, which offers serene views. Indulge in luxury at the Stowe Country Club, where you can enjoy exquisite amenities and a peaceful atmosphere.

Adventure

Experience the thrill of winter sports at Smugglers' Notch Ski Area, located 2 miles away, offering fantastic skiing opportunities. Take the Stowe Gondola, 4 miles away, for stunning mountain views. For outdoor enthusiasts, visit Cantilever Rock, also 4 miles away, for breathtaking scenery and adventure vibes.

Nightlife

In Smugglers Notch, the Stowe Theatre Guild offers a charming atmosphere with cultural performances just 10 miles away. For a unique film experience, The Big Picture Theater & Cafe, located 28 miles away, combines cinema with romance. Meanwhile, Saint Michael's Playhouse, 20 miles away, showcases family-friendly entertainment.
